How To Fix SDMI116 - Last uptime release only relevant for migr. classes with uptime migration


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SDMI - Messages of SDMI

  • Message number: 116

  • Message text: Last uptime release only relevant for migr. classes with uptime migration

    The SAP error message SDMI116 indicates that the last uptime release is only relevant for migration classes that involve uptime migration. This error typically arises during the migration process when the system is trying to validate or process data related to migration classes that are not compatible with the current settings or configurations.

    Cause:

    1. Incompatible Migration Class: The migration class you are trying to use may not support the last uptime release. This can happen if the migration class is designed for a different version or if it is not configured correctly.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ration settings in your SAP system that prevent the migration process from recognizing the appropriate classes.
    3. Data Inconsistencies: There could be inconsistencies or missing data in the migration objects that are required for the process to complete successfully.

    Solution:

    1. Check Migration Class Compatibility: Ensure that the migration class you are using is compatible with the last uptime release. You may need to consult SAP documentation or support to verify this.
    2. Review Configuration Settings: Go through the configuration settings related to the migration process. Make sure that all necessary parameters are set correctly and that there are no discrepancies.
    3. Data Validation: Validate the data that you are trying to migrate. Ensure that all required fields are populated and that there are no inconsistencies in the data.
    4. Consult SAP Notes: Look for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. SAP frequently releases updates and patches that can resolve known issues.
    5.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. They can provide more detailed insights based on your specific system configuration and the error message.
